74.18 percent of the population in 79520 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 44.05 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 13.59 percent of the residents in 79520 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.89 members with about 2.35 cars available per household.
An estimate of 83.58 percent of the residents in 79520 has some form of health insurance. 38.24 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 58.13 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 79520 would have to travel an average of 15.34 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Anson General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 79520, Hamlin, Texas.

As of , an estimate of 2,393 residents live in 79520 with a median age of 37.0 years. 31.01 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 19.77 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 36.72 percent of the residents in 79520 is currently married, and 9.18 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 79520 is $5,654.92.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 79520 is approximately $774. The median household spends about 13.69 percent of their income on housing.

COPD, or chronic obstructive pulmonary disease, is a chronic inflammatory lung disease that causes obstructed airflow from the lungs. It is typically characterized by increasing breathlessness. Managing COPD requires regular medical attention and access to healthcare facilities.
